couple.gif (8688 bytes)Welcome! Kent State students will be traveling to Hanyang University in beautiful Seoul, South Korea for 4 weeks and Xi'an China for 1 week during the summer of 2007. You can join this program and not only have a great adventure, you will get to choose from a wide range of great courses and get academic credit. And, all the classes are in English. What do I need once I am in Korea? Lots! Click here to find out more. Once you arrive in Korea, you will need to go through customs, get to Hanyang University, and get set up in your dorm room. Once there, you will attend courses in English that cover a wide range of subjects on Asia and America, such as history, language, politics, sociology, economics, and many more.
